Output 30e06fa0390dee29b63d95a94799186d6337d028532275d803d4e8169d30f12a:17

value
23050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76f885d2cb6f0af57a8aa655023c79cd1ad50239 OP_EQUALVERIFY OP_CHECKSIG
address
1Br4TJMb8QKwEXa7qGUZKyq66Jf14RCnfq
transaction
30e06fa0390dee29b63d95a94799186d6337d028532275d803d4e8169d30f12a
spent
true